Abstract

The cellular phone usage has been growing dramatically over the last decade and became a crucial part of our life. One of the key components of mobile phone is the antenna that receives and transmits electromagnetic (EM) energy. The safety of human head exposure of electromagnetic (EM) waves emitted from cell phones has attracted public concern. A comprehensive review of recent approaches and techniques of electromagnetic absorption reduction over GSM bands are presented in this paper. Protection attachments between the antenna and the human head were proposed by many researchers. These distinct techniques have been classified in to 4 categories including the use of ferrite sheet, perfect electric conductor (PEC), electromagnetic band gap (EBG) structure and metamaterials. Few good papers were reviewed and evaluated in each group for proof of concept. Finally, a comparison between these techniques was done.
